Study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ine whether the MEL 80 Excimer Laser is effective in the treatment of mixed astigmatism up to 6.0 D, when used as part of the Laser In Situ Keratomileusis (LASIK) procedure.
Interventions
- DEVICE MEL 80 Mixed Astigmatism Treatment
